Redmon Bridge and before you get to the rest area. It`s called the Yakima Research Station and is one of two National Security Agency eavesdropping stations in the United States. (The other ``secret`` facility is in Sugar Grove, W.Va.) And I expect some readers may be concerned that we have revealed this well-kept secret. We haven`t. In truth, it isn`t much of a secret at all — and it hasn`t been for some time. But the attention the Yakima facility receives has intensified since a New York Times report on Christmas Day by James Bamford, a former ABC News producer who first documented the installation 24 years ago in his book ``The Puzzle Palace.`` Bamford`s Dec. 25 piece was actually about the Sugar Grove facility, which he described in detail, including the information that it was one of two major NSA listening posts in the United States. He mentioned in almost an off-hand manner that the other site was in Yakima, Wash. In the years I`ve been in Yakima, I`ve seen the installation east of I-82 innumerable times, and I`ve been told by at least a dozen people that it was an NSA facility. I`ve even told other people that, all the time unsure of whether I was just passing along an urban myth. But I had never checked it out, until I read the Bamford article on Christmas Day. That`s when I Googled the phrase ``Yakima Research Station.`` I was rewarded with 1,100 hits, some with detailed information that even included topographic maps of the site within the Yakima Training Center. And that`s when we decided we needed to tell our readers more. As reporter Chris Bristol discovered in trying to gather information for his front-page story today, official sources aren`t willing to say much about the Yakima Research Station. In fact, mentioning the initials ``NSA`` is enough to shut up just about anyone. But it has existed just north of Yakima for nearly three decades, and we believe people here have a right to know what stands watch in our backyard. That leads to my last point about why we in the Yakima Valley need to know about this site: It presents a target we may not have known existed. We knew about other potential targets for terrorism around the United States, even around the area. Hanford? Yes. The Umatilla Army Depot? Yes. The region`s major hydroelectric dams? Yes. The military installations around the Puget Sound? Yes, yes and yes. A major NSA site just outside our community? I have to believe the answer is yes. I hope you found Chris` research as fascinating as I did — because now when I drive to Ellensburg and glimpse those white buildings and satellite dishes off to the east, I will have a better understanding of what I`m seeing. And when I read continuing reporting about NSA eavesdropping — or the United States` ``terrorist surveillance program,`` as President Bush has termed it — I will have a better understanding of Yakima`s role. And the risk we run by living in its shadow. * Sarah Jenkins is editor of the Yakima Herald-Republic. If you have a question or concern, you can reach her at 577-7703: P.O.
